The album is a dark, cohesive, and deeply reflective examination of late-90s society, the music industry, and personal morality. From the frantic urgency of "The Next Movement" to the haunting storytelling of "Act Too (The Love of My Life)" featuring Common, the record moves like a living, breathing entity. It did not rely on recycled radio loops; it relied on the human clockwork of Ahmir "Questlove" Thompson’s drumming and the unmatched cadence of Tariq "Black Thought" Trotter. the roots things fall apart rar 320 better

This critical and commercial validation was long overdue. The album peaked at No. 4 on the Billboard 200 charts, went platinum, and is rightfully considered the band's magnum opus. The album’s legacy secured The Roots' future, eventually leading them to become the house band for *The Tonight Show Starring Jimmy Fallon.

Things Fall Apart was both a critical darling and a commercial breakthrough, earning the band their first remaster-worthy Grammy win for the hit single "You Got Me," featuring Erykah Badu and Eve. The album acts as a historical document of the Soulquarians era—a collective of artists including D'Angelo, Common, and J Dilla who reshaped the boundaries of Black music.
